Hierarchy For All Packages

Package Hierarchies:

Class Hierarchy

  • java.lang.Object
    • io.github.retrooper.packetevents.util.folia.AsyncScheduler
    • io.github.retrooper.packetevents.netty.buffer.ByteBufAllocationOperatorModernImpl (implements com.github.retrooper.packetevents.netty.buffer.ByteBufAllocationOperator)
    • io.github.retrooper.packetevents.netty.buffer.ByteBufOperatorModernImpl (implements com.github.retrooper.packetevents.netty.buffer.ByteBufOperator)
    • io.netty.channel.ChannelHandlerAdapter (implements io.netty.channel.ChannelHandler)
      • io.netty.channel.ChannelInboundHandlerAdapter (implements io.netty.channel.ChannelInboundHandler)
      • io.netty.channel.ChannelOutboundHandlerAdapter (implements io.netty.channel.ChannelOutboundHandler)
        • io.netty.handler.codec.MessageToMessageEncoder<I>
    • io.github.retrooper.packetevents.netty.channel.ChannelOperatorModernImpl (implements com.github.retrooper.packetevents.netty.channel.ChannelOperator)
    • io.github.retrooper.packetevents.util.viaversion.CustomPipelineUtil
    • io.github.retrooper.packetevents.util.folia.EntityScheduler
    • io.github.retrooper.packetevents.util.FoliaCompatUtil
    • io.github.retrooper.packetevents.util.folia.FoliaScheduler
    • io.github.retrooper.packetevents.util.GeyserUtil
    • io.github.retrooper.packetevents.util.folia.GlobalRegionScheduler
    • io.github.retrooper.packetevents.util.InjectedList<E> (implements java.util.List<E>)
    • io.github.retrooper.packetevents.bukkit.InternalBukkitListener (implements org.bukkit.event.Listener)
    • com.github.retrooper.packetevents.util.LogManager
    • io.github.retrooper.packetevents.netty.NettyManagerImpl (implements com.github.retrooper.packetevents.netty.NettyManager)
    • com.github.retrooper.packetevents.event.PacketListenerCommon
      • com.github.retrooper.packetevents.event.PacketListenerAbstract
    • io.github.retrooper.packetevents.manager.player.PlayerManagerImpl (implements com.github.retrooper.packetevents.manager.player.PlayerManager)
    • io.github.retrooper.packetevents.util.PlayerPingAccessorModern
    • org.bukkit.plugin.PluginBase (implements org.bukkit.plugin.Plugin)
    • io.github.retrooper.packetevents.manager.protocol.ProtocolManagerImpl (implements com.github.retrooper.packetevents.manager.protocol.ProtocolManager)
    • io.github.retrooper.packetevents.util.folia.RegionScheduler
    • io.github.retrooper.packetevents.injector.connection.ServerConnectionInitializer
    • io.github.retrooper.packetevents.manager.server.ServerManagerImpl (implements com.github.retrooper.packetevents.manager.server.ServerManager)
    • io.github.retrooper.packetevents.injector.SpigotChannelInjector (implements com.github.retrooper.packetevents.injector.ChannelInjector)
    • io.github.retrooper.packetevents.util.SpigotConversionUtil
    • io.github.retrooper.packetevents.factory.spigot.SpigotPacketEventsBuilder
    • io.github.retrooper.packetevents.util.SpigotReflectionUtil
    • io.github.retrooper.packetevents.util.folia.TaskWrapper
    • io.github.retrooper.packetevents.util.viaversion.ViaVersionAccessorImpl (implements io.github.retrooper.packetevents.util.viaversion.ViaVersionAccessor)
    • io.github.retrooper.packetevents.util.viaversion.ViaVersionAccessorImplLegacy (implements io.github.retrooper.packetevents.util.viaversion.ViaVersionAccessor)
    • io.github.retrooper.packetevents.util.viaversion.ViaVersionUtil

Interface Hierarchy